Cyclic AMP

It is a protein kinase activator and a derivative of nucleotides. It is an important substance with physiological activity that is widely present in the human body. It is produced by adenosine triphosphate under the catalysis of adenylate cyclase and can regulate various functional activities of cells. As the second messenger of hormones, it plays a role in regulating physiological functions and material metabolism in cells, can change the function of cell membranes, promote calcium ions in reticulum to enter muscle fibers, thereby enhancing myocardial contraction, and can promote the activity of respiratory chain oxidases, improve myocardial hypoxia, relieve symptoms of coronary heart disease and improve electrocardiograms. In addition, it plays an important role in regulating sugar, fat metabolism, nucleic acid, and protein synthesis.

Gabexate mesylate

Gabexate is a non-peptide protease inhibitor that can inhibit the activity of proteases such as trypsin, kallikrein, plasmin, and thrombin, thereby preventing the pathological and physiological changes caused by these enzymes. In animal experimental acute pancreatitis, it can inhibit activated trypsin and reduce pancreatic damage. At the same time, the increase in serum amylase, lipase activity, and urea nitrogen is also significantly improved.
